Qualified after a victory in 3 sets (4-6 6-0 6-2) against Loïc Le Panse and Nico Trancart, the seeded number 2 pockets the first ticket for the final of this 2022 edition of the French championships.

A tense 1st set…and a surprise 

Bastien Blanqué and Thomas Leygue, seeded number 2 in this competition, were the favorites for this meeting. However, it was also certain that the pair Le Panse / Trancart did not come to do figuration. Haloed by their status as outsiders, the two men did not seem timorous at the start of the meeting.

It's even quite the opposite: they managed to take the service of their opponents twice in the first set (losing their advantage the first time, before keeping it until the end of the set)! Opposite, Bastien and Thomas did not play badly but they were often outplayed on important points by their opponents. 

And this tenacity was also seen through a few contentious points at the end of the set, which did not fail to crystallize the tension weighing on this meeting. With the high point, this set point won by Loïc and Nico but which was contested by Thomas and Bastien, creating an extremely confused situation between their players.

Score of the set: 6-4 Le Panse / Trancart

2nd set: Blanqué/Leygue set the record straight 

The awakening was brutal. Leaving the annoyance on the chair, the Blanqué / Leygue pair returned with better intentions. We can say that the steamroller started gradually.

As for Nico Trancart and Loïc Le Panse, the drop in intensity was substantial. No longer able to really hang on, the two men could no longer find the solutions on the track. One way, Thomas and Bastien pocketed the set without losing the slightest game.

Score of the set: 6-0 Blanqué / Leygue 

3rd set: Blanqué/Leygue with style 

In appearance, the 3rd and 2nd sets were almost similar. The Blanqué / Leygue pair continued to gain momentum, while the Trancart / Le Panse pair opposite seemed to suffer more and more and no longer find the resources necessary to reverse the trend.

Solid and sure of their strength, Bastien and Thomas will have lost only two small games in the 3rd round before pocketing the set and the final victory. 

Final score: 4-6 6-0 6-2 Blanqué / Leygue
